In the context of avoiding lock issues in complex Salesforce implementations, taking proactive measures in architecture is essential. Proactive architectural measures involve planning the design and structure of your data model to minimize the risks associated with lookup skew. Lookup skew refers to a scenario where a large number of child records are associated with a single parent record, leading to potential locking and performance issues when these records are frequently edited or updated.

By adopting proactive strategies such as segmenting data into more manageable structures, ensuring proper record associations, and maintaining a balanced number of child records related to each parent, the overall system becomes more resilient to lock scenarios. This approach allows for smoother operations, reduces contention among records, and can enhance overall performance and user experience.

While managing the number of lookup fields and creating more parent records can contribute positively to the structure, they do not inherently address the systemic design issues that proactive architecture can resolve. Carelessness in record associations, while a concern, can be mitigated through careful architectural planning, reinforcing the importance of a well-thought-out design to prevent issues before they arise.
